If we really want to maximize view for scanned book (pdf) then the best way (when sony's autocrop + fit-to-landscape is not good enough) IMHO is to use Briss(or Pdfscissors) for cropping the white borders and then simply print-to-file this cropped pdf in Adobe Reader 11 (or Acrobat) using Posters mode (Tile mode in Acrobat) for Sony screen dimensions (about 120x90 mm).
It will take about five minutes for cropping and another five minutes for printing of an average book on average laptop.

Of course this is not recommended for A4 sized pdf's (21 cm page width) but for pdf's with page width less than 16-17 cm (6 inch).
For A4 pdf scans we can use reflow in k2pdfopt beforehand or if it is 2-column (or 3-column) A4 pdf use Sony's 2-column mode.
